Hi...
GERD can take up to 4 to 6 weeks to show relief with meds...now u also mentioned u r on antibiotics, they can add to the problem, so it could take longer.
Has ur Dr informed u to modify ur diet and lifestyle?
Stress can also affect how u feel....so do try to relax, but if not going to work is stressing u out more than going , than go ...this is no reason to stay home.
Smoking is a lifestyle modification u will need to do asap to help...smoking will make u feel worse with this condition....http://www.medhelp.org/gerd/articles/What-is-Heartburn/247
